Your Guide to Shiny, Happy Wood: Choosing the Best Wood Cleaner and Polish

Wood furniture and surfaces add warmth and beauty to your home. Keeping them looking their best requires the right care. A good wood cleaner and polish can bring back their shine and protect them. This guide will help you pick the perfect product.

1. Key Features to Look For

The Best Products Do These Things:
  • Cleans Effectively: It should remove dust, grime, and fingerprints without leaving a residue.
  • Polishes and Shines: It brings out the natural beauty of the wood and gives it a healthy sheen.
  • Protects the Wood: Some formulas offer a protective layer against moisture and minor scratches.
  • Pleasant Scent: A fresh, mild scent is a bonus, not an overpowering smell.
  • Easy to Use: It should be simple to apply and buff without much effort.

2. Important Materials

What’s inside the bottle matters. Look for products with natural ingredients when possible. These are often gentler on your wood and better for the environment.

Common Ingredients You Might Find:
  • Natural Oils: Like linseed oil or mineral oil, these nourish the wood.
  • Waxes: Beeswax or carnauba wax add shine and a protective layer.
  • Water: Often the base for cleaning agents.
  • Mild Soaps: To help lift dirt and grime.
  • Fragrances: For a pleasant smell.

Avoid products with harsh chemicals like ammonia or strong solvents. These can damage the wood’s finish over time.

3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

What Makes a Product Great (or Not So Great):
  • Formula Type: Sprays are convenient, while creams or liquids might offer deeper conditioning.
  • Finish Compatibility: Make sure the product works with your wood’s finish (e.g., polyurethane, lacquer, wax). Some cleaners are all-purpose, while others are specific.
  • Residue Left Behind: A high-quality product should dry clear and not feel sticky. A sticky residue means it might attract more dust.
  • Durability of Shine: Does the shine last for days or just a few hours? Longer-lasting shine is a sign of good quality.
  • Ease of Buffing: Some products are easy to wipe away and buff to a shine. Others can be streaky or require a lot of elbow grease.

4. User Experience and Use Cases

How you use the cleaner and polish affects the results. Most products are straightforward. You typically spray or apply the product to a cloth and then wipe down the wood. After letting it sit for a moment, you buff it with a clean, dry cloth until it shines.

Great for Many Situations:
  • Everyday Dusting: Keep your furniture looking fresh daily.
  • Restoring Old Furniture: Bring back the luster to antique pieces.
  • Protecting New Wood: Help new cabinets and tables maintain their look.
  • Removing Smudges: Clean up fingerprints from tables and doors.
  • Giving a Deep Clean: Use it when your wood needs more than just a quick wipe.

Always test a new product in an inconspicuous spot first. This ensures it won’t harm your wood’s finish.

Frequently Asked Questions About Wood Cleaner and Polish

Q: What is the main difference between wood cleaner and wood polish?

A: A wood cleaner focuses on removing dirt and grime. A wood polish adds shine and can offer some protection. Many products combine both functions.

Q: Can I use wood cleaner and polish on all types of wood?

A: Most are safe for finished wood surfaces. However, always check the product label. Some might not be suitable for unfinished or oiled wood.

Q: How often should I clean and polish my wood furniture?

A: For daily dusting, a dry cloth is usually enough. Use a cleaner and polish about once a month or whenever the wood looks dull or dirty.

Q: Will wood polish damage my wood if I use it too much?

A: Generally, no. However, using too much can lead to a buildup. Follow the product instructions and wipe away any excess.

Q: Can I use wood cleaner and polish on painted wood?

A: It depends on the paint. For most sealed or varnished painted surfaces, a gentle cleaner is fine. Test in a small area first.

Q: What should I do if a wood cleaner leaves streaks?

A: Use a clean, dry microfiber cloth to buff the area again. You might have used too much product, or the cloth might be dirty.

Q: Are there natural or DIY wood cleaner and polish options?

A: Yes. Many people use olive oil and lemon juice, or vinegar and water mixtures. However, commercial products are often formulated for better results and protection.

Q: Can I use wood cleaner and polish on my kitchen cabinets?

A: Yes, especially if they have a finished surface. They help remove grease and grime that can build up.

Q: Does wood polish fill in scratches?

A: Most wood polishes do not fill in deep scratches. They can sometimes make minor surface scuffs less noticeable by adding shine.

Q: Where should I store my wood cleaner and polish?

A: Store them in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and heat. This helps maintain their effectiveness.
